Spectrum analysis - force spectrum

Hello,

Is it possible to define force spectrum in RSA?

No, it is not possible.

Spectrum analysis available in Robot concerns movement of soil and is related to seismic effects.

 

Your reference added to the already existing wish of such feature:)

 

And just a side question related to force spectrum: for what type of loads would you like to use such analysis? wind? something else?

this is what i thought.

 

Yes, exactly for wind load. At the moment it is super complicated to analyze high slender structures(with non symetric cores position), sensetive to wind dynamic loads(with small natural frequenicies). Present codes(eurocode, russian code) give a reference to spectrum analysis.
